Why Do Mechanical Engineers Need Job-Oriented Courses?
While a mechanical engineering degree provides strong technical knowledge, it often does not align directly with current industry demands—especially when applying for jobs in the Middle East or industrial sectors.
Key reasons engineers pursue skill-based courses include:
- High competition in core engineering jobs
- Lack of practical, industry-specific skills
- Growing demand for safety-certified professionals abroad
- Quick employment through short-term certifications
Top 5 Job-Oriented Courses After Mechanical Engineering in Kerala
1. NEBOSH IGC (International General Certificate)
NEBOSH is one of the most in-demand safety certifications worldwide. It prepares you for roles such as Safety Officer, HSE Engineer, and Compliance Manager.
Benefits:
- Recognized globally in over 130 countries
- High salary potential, especially in the Gulf region
- Certification completed in 45–60 days
- Ideal for mechanical engineers seeking a shift to industrial safety

2. Diploma in Fire and Safety Mangement
This course is ideal for mechanical engineers looking to work in construction, oil and gas, and manufacturing industries. The curriculum includes fire prevention, safety regulations, and emergency response protocols.
Career Roles:
- Fire Safety Officer
- Site Safety Supervisor
- Safety Compliance Inspector
3. Industrial Safety Diploma
Focused on factory and plant safety, this course provides knowledge on:
- Hazard identification
- Workplace risk management
- Environmental health and safety laws
Suitable for engineers who want to work in power plants, chemical factories, and heavy industries.
4. HVAC (Heating, Ventilation, and Air Conditioning)
HVAC design and implementation is a skill set that remains in constant demand. Engineers with HVAC certification find job opportunities in commercial buildings, airports, malls, and hospitals.
5. Piping Design and Drafting
A specialized course that’s useful for engineers interested in working in petrochemical industries, shipyards, and oil refineries. Training includes 2D and 3D piping layouts, design standards, and software like AutoCAD and PDMS.
